Course Details


• Introduction to Festival Environmental Impact Assessment
• Understanding Environmental Legislation and Policy for Festivals
• Identifying and Evaluating Environmental Impacts of Festivals
• Best Practices for Waste Management and Reduction at Festivals
• Energy Efficiency and Renewable Energy Solutions for Festivals
• Water Conservation and Management in Festival Planning
• Reducing Air Pollution and Noise Pollution at Festivals
• Stakeholder Engagement and Communication Strategies for Festival EIAs
• Monitoring and Reporting on Festival Environmental Performance
• Sustainable Transportation Options for Festival Attendees
• Case Studies: Successful Festival EIAs and Sustainable Event Management

Career Path

The Certificate in Festival Environmental Impact Assessment is a valuable credential for professionals engaged in event planning and environmental management. As the industry prioritizes sustainability, a range of roles have emerged, each requiring a specific skill set to minimize environmental impacts. This 3D pie chart illustrates the job market trends for these roles in the UK. 1. **Festival Event Coordinator**: With a 30% share of the market, these professionals organize eco-friendly events and ensure sustainable practices throughout the festival lifecycle. 2. **Environmental Consultant**: Comprising 25% of the market, environmental consultants assess the environmental impact of festivals and provide recommendations for improvement. 3. **Waste Management Specialist**: With a 20% share, waste management specialists focus on minimizing waste and maximizing recycling efforts during festivals. 4. **Sustainability Analyst**: Representing 15% of the market, sustainability analysts measure and report on the environmental performance of festivals, helping to identify areas for improvement. 5. **Carbon Footprint Consultant**: This role accounts for 10% of the market, focusing on reducing carbon emissions associated with festivals, transportation, and audience travel. These roles reflect the growing importance of environmental consciousness in the events industry.
